Career Path

In the UK, advocacy for Sensory Processing Disorder (SPD) is a growing field, with various roles in demand. Based on recent studies, special education teachers, occupational therapists, speech-language pathologists, pediatricians, and psychologists play significant roles in this area. Let's dive into the details of these professions and their relevance in the SPD industry: 1. **Special Education Teachers**: These educators work closely with students with various learning difficulties, including SPD. They adapt teaching strategies to cater to individual needs, ensuring an inclusive and supportive learning environment. 2. **Occupational Therapists**: OTs focus on helping individuals with SPD perform daily tasks more efficiently by developing and improving their sensory processing abilities. They design personalized intervention programs, incorporating various sensory-rich activities. 3. **Speech-Language Pathologists**: SLPs address communication and swallowing challenges often associated with SPD. They create tailored treatment plans to improve speech, language, and feeding skills in children with SPD. 4. **Pediatricians**: Pediatricians diagnose and manage SPD, collaborating with other professionals to develop comprehensive care plans. They monitor children's overall health and development, ensuring appropriate interventions are in place. 5. **Psychologists**: Psychologists assess and diagnose SPD, offering counseling and support services for affected individuals and their families. They also play a crucial role in raising awareness and understanding of SPD in the community.
